Question

is there any possibility to add images inside the invoice not as attachments on email. Simply when the PDF is created, images should be visible there, even on a new page.

Thank you for reaching out with your concern, @siththammandiraya. The option to add images to an invoice is currently unavailable in QuickBooks Online. However, if you prefer not to include them as email attachments, I have another workaround that may work for you. You can incorporate images into the Products or Service section or add them to your logo. I'm here to guide you through the process.

 

To add an image in the Product or Service section of the Invoice, kindly follow these steps:

 

  1. Click + New, under the Customers column, choose Invoice.
  2. In the Product or service section, select + Add new under Product/service column.
  3. Here, you can choose the type: Inventory, Non-inventory, Service, or Bundle.
  4. After selection, click on the Pencil icon under the image icon to add images.
  5. Once done, select Save and close.
